How Virtual Reality Gaming Works
At its core, virtual reality gaming relies on head-mounted displays that track the user’s head movements in real time, updating the on-screen view to match the direction and angle of the user’s gaze. This creates a convincing sense of presence, as if the player is actually inside the digital world. Modern systems often include motion controllers, haptic feedback gloves, or full-body tracking sensors to allow natural hand and body motions to translate into in-game actions. The combination of low-latency tracking, high-resolution displays, and spatial audio produces an environment where the boundary between reality and simulation blurs significantly.
Key Platforms and Hardware
The current virtual reality gaming ecosystem is supported by several major platforms. High-end devices such as the Valve Index and PlayStation VR2 deliver premium experiences with advanced optics and robust tracking capabilities. Meanwhile, standalone headsets like the Meta Quest series have democratized access by eliminating the need for a powerful external computer or console. These all-in-one devices integrate processing, storage, and battery into a wireless unit, making virtual reality more convenient for everyday use. Additionally, hybrid systems such as the Apple Vision Pro and the HTC Vive XR Elite bridge virtual and augmented reality, offering new modes of interaction. The competitive landscape continues to drive innovation, with each generation of hardware reducing weight, improving visual fidelity, and enhancing comfort for extended play sessions.
Immersive Gaming Experiences
Virtual reality has expanded the boundaries of interactive entertainment by enabling genres that are difficult to replicate on flat screens. Rhythm games require players to physically move to beat patterns, fostering a unique combination of exercise and entertainment. Horror titles leverage the intense sense of immersion to create visceral reactions, while puzzle and adventure games exploit the ability to reach out, grab, and manipulate objects as if they were real. Social platforms, such as VRChat and Rec Room, host millions of users who interact, create, and explore together in shared virtual spaces. Benefits for Players and Industries
Beyond entertainment, virtual reality gaming offers several measurable advantages. Regular engagement with active virtual reality games can improve physical fitness, hand-eye coordination, and spatial awareness. For individuals with limited mobility, these platforms provide safe, accessible environments for movement and exploration. In educational contexts, virtual reality simulations allow students to experiment with historical reconstructions, scientific models, and complex systems in ways that traditional media cannot match. The healthcare sector also benefits, using virtual reality for rehabilitation, pain management, and exposure therapy. As the technology matures, cross-industry applications continue to multiply, reinforcing its value as a versatile tool.
Challenges and Limitations
Despite its rapid growth, virtual reality gaming faces notable hurdles. The most significant is the physical discomfort known as motion sickness, which can occur when there is a disconnect between visual motion and the body’s vestibular system. Motion sickness affects a subset of users and has motivated developers to adopt design strategies such as teleportation movement and fixed reference points. Another challenge is the cost of high-performance hardware, which remains a barrier for many potential users. Furthermore, the requirement for dedicated physical space can be impractical in small living environments. Software development is also more complex and expensive than traditional game development due to the need for optimized rendering, intuitive interface design, and rigorous testing across diverse hardware configurations.
Future Directions and Trends
The trajectory of virtual reality gaming points toward increased realism, portability, and social integration. Advances in foveated rendering—a technique that reduces graphical detail in peripheral vision—allow for higher frame rates and more detailed worlds without overwhelming processing power. Eye-tracking and facial expression capture are being integrated into next-generation headsets, enabling more natural social cues in multiplayer environments. The emergence of cloud gaming services is also poised to offload computational demands, potentially making high-end virtual reality experiences accessible on lower-cost devices. Meanwhile, the convergence of virtual and augmented reality will likely create seamless transitions between digital overlays and fully immersive worlds. As 5G and edge computing expand, latency will decrease, further enhancing real-time interaction.
